About South Park
South Park, located in Surrey, England, is a public park that offers a variety of facilities for visitors. It features well-maintained paths suitable for walking and jogging, as well as open green spaces ideal for picnics and outdoor activities. There are children's play areas, making it a popular spot for families. The park also hosts several events throughout the year, encouraging community engagement.
The park is easily accessible and provides a peaceful environment for those looking to enjoy nature. There are benches scattered throughout, allowing visitors to relax and take in their surroundings. South Park is also home to a range of trees and plants, contributing to its pleasant atmosphere. Whether for a leisurely stroll or a family outing, South Park serves as a valuable recreational space for the local community.
School Ratings in South Park
South Park is served by 68 schools. Reigate Priory Community Junior School and Reigate Parish Church Primary School are each rated Outstanding by Ofsted. A further 7 schools hold a Good rating.
House Prices in South Park
Property prices average £660K across the area, and flats are the most common property type, typically selling for £322K.

Household Income in South Park ONS 2023
The average total household income in South Park is approximately £74,710 a year before tax, 35% above the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£53,043.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in South Park ONS 2025
There are approximately 1,660 active businesses based in South Park, around 60 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 88%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 38 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in South Park
Of the 10,936 households in and around South Park, 72% are owned, 12% are socially rented and 16%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ering South Park.
